Station address (ST)
Description of communication parameter settings
− Station address (ST)
This address is used to identify the controller in bus or modem mode. In a system, each
controller needs to be assigned a unique address.

10.2 Memory module/mini module

The use of a memory module (order no. 1400-9379) or a mini module (order no. 1400-
7436) is particularly useful to transfer all data from one TROVIS 5573 Controller to several
other TROVIS 5573 Controllers.
Note
In contrast to the memory module, the mini module is not suitable for transferring the pro-
grammed vacations to the individual control circuits or a data logging configuration pro-
grammed in TROVIS-VIEW.
The memory module/mini module is plugged into the RJ-45 connector socket located at the
side of the controller. Once the module has been connected, '73 SP' appears on the control-
ler display. If the memory module already contains data from a different TROVIS 5573 Con-
troller, turn the rotary pushbutton until 'SP 73' is displayed.
− Pressing the rotary pushbutton to confirm '73 SP' causes the controller settings to be
transferred to the memory module/mini module.
